Dizzee began MCing on pirate radio and at raves at fifteen, but since his mainstream success he has distanced himself from the fledgling scene. Rascal grew up in the East End of London in south Bow in a council estate, raised by his single mother, a Ghanaian immigrant. Little is known about his father, though it is thought that he died when Mills was two. He attributes his musical development to a school teacher who allowed him to skip regular classes and spend time working on music on the school computers.
His music is an eclectic mixture of garage and hip-hop beats with an extremely broad palette of influences, ranging from metal guitars to found sounds, drill and bass synth lines, eclectic samples and even Japanese court music. His vocal performance is also distinctive, he uses a fast version of rapping (known as 'spitting') which blends elements from garage MCing, conventional rap, grime and ragga.
Dizzee Rascal has numerous rivals within the Grime scene, mainly from the Bow, East London area. A notable rival of Dizzee Rascal is Crazy Titch who produced and recorded a diss called "Just An Arsehole" which used the backing track of Dizzee's record of "Jus A Rascal".
Dizzee Rascal has had international endorsements deals with urban brand Ecko and designed his own shoe with Nike. He has also worked with cross genre artist, Beck, on a remix of the song Hell Yes.
He released his debut album in 2003, which was called Boy In Da Corner, winning him the 2003 Mercury Prize. His second album Showtime was released in 2004. His third effort, Maths and English was released in 2007. All three albums received critical acclaim. He experienced commercial success in 2008 when Dance Wiv Me reached the number one spot in the UK charts. His fourth album, Tongue n' Cheek was released in 2009, going platinum for sales exceeding 300,000 units in the UK. Dizzee Rascal's album The Fifth was released in 2013, the same year he received an honorary Doctorate of the Arts from the University of East London.
In 2017, Rascal released Raskit, which as well as building on his sound heralded a return on some songs to the grime sound of his earlier albums.

The song "Bassline Junkie" by Dizzee Rascal is a celebration of the power of electronic dance music (EDM) and its ability to move people. The lyrics are an unapologetic statement of the singer's love for bass-heavy music, which they describe as "big dirty stinking base." The repetition of "dirty stinking base" throughout the song creates a sense of urgency and excitement that mirrors the rush of the music itself.
The singer declares that they don't need drugs like speed, heroin, or cocaine to experience a high because they are a "bassline junkie." They crave the intense physical sensation of the bassline and the way it takes them to a higher level of consciousness. The singer says that when they hear a bassline, they can't control their actions but they still feel satisfied. They reject the idea that their love for EDM is a bad habit and tell anyone who tries to take it away from them that they'll "blow your fucking face away."
In the bridge, the singer describes how they got an ASBO order (an anti-social behavior order) for playing their music too loud, but they refuse to be silenced. They see themselves as the "bassline father" and are willing to face the consequences of their actions to continue living life to the fullest.
Overall, "Bassline Junkie" is a celebration of the transformative power of music and its ability to bring people together. The singer's love for bass-heavy music is a declaration of their identity and a symbol of their refusal to conform to society's expectations.
